Insight Timer Competitors & Top Alternatives 2026

Insight Timer is the world's largest free meditation library, offering over 200,000 guided meditations, music tracks, and talks from independent teachers and practitioners. Its marketplace model allows teachers to offer courses and live events, creating a community-driven platform rather than an in-house content library. The app also features a meditation timer, community groups, and live meditation events.

Market Position

Insight Timer differentiates from Headspace and Calm through its community-driven, largely free content model. While Headspace and Calm invest in polished in-house content behind paywalls, Insight Timer's teacher marketplace provides massive scale at lower cost. Its 200K+ session library dwarfs competitors, though content quality varies more widely without editorial curation.

Strategic Analysis

Free Content as Growth Engine

Insight Timer's massive free library attracts users who resist Headspace and Calm's subscription paywalls. This free-first approach builds the largest user base in meditation apps, though monetizing free users through premium features and teacher courses remains a revenue challenge.

Teacher Marketplace Model

Insight Timer's teacher marketplace scales content without in-house production costs. This creates variety but also quality variance. The platform must balance open contribution with curation to maintain content standards as the library grows.

Community as Retention Mechanic

Live meditation events, discussion groups, and teacher followings create community bonds that individual practice apps lack. This social layer increases retention through relationship-based engagement rather than content-based engagement alone.

Frequently Asked Questions

Who are Insight Timer's main competitors?

Insight Timer competes with Headspace (structured courses), Calm (sleep and relaxation), Ten Percent Happier (evidence-based), and Waking Up (philosophical depth). Unlike its competitors, Insight Timer's core library is free, making it the largest meditation app by session count.

How does Insight Timer compare to Headspace?

Insight Timer offers 200K+ free sessions from independent teachers, while Headspace has a curated, in-house library behind a subscription wall. Insight Timer has more content variety; Headspace has more consistent quality and structured learning paths.

What is Insight Timer's competitive advantage?

Insight Timer's core advantage is the world's largest free meditation library with 200K+ sessions. Its community-driven marketplace model scales content at low cost, and live meditation events create social engagement that solitary meditation apps cannot replicate.
